A train trip from Grantham to North Queensferry takes about 5hrs 43 mins on average, covering roughly 241 miles (388 kilometres). With around 21 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£37.80,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

The travel time between Grantham and North Queensferry by train varies depending on the type of train and the route, but the average journey time is 5hrs 43 mins & the fastest journey takes 4hrs 39 mins.
The fastest journey time by train from Grantham to North Queensferry is 4hrs 39 mins.
Train ticket prices from Grantham to North Queensferry can start from as little as £37.80 when you book in advance. The cost of tickets can vary depending on the time of day, route and class you book and are usually more expensive if you book on the day.
The departure and arrival times for trains between Grantham and North Queensferry vary depending on the day of the week and the type of train. Generally, there are around 21 departures and arrivals throughout the day. The first departure is 07:28, and the last train of the day leaves at 01:14.
First class tickets on trains between Grantham and North Queensferry typically offer more space, complimentary food and drink, and other amenities compared to standard class.
Amenities on trains between Grantham and North Queensferry can include free Wi-Fi, power outlets, onboard catering, and comfortable seating.

No, unfortunately there are no direct trains between Grantham & North Queensferry. However, there are 21 possible journeys which require a change.
First Hull Trains, CrossCountry, ScotRail, Lumo and London North Eastern Railway are the main train operating companies running services between Grantham and North Queensferry.
Yes, you can bring luggage on board trains between Grantham and North Queensferry, but there may be limits on the number of bags or the size and weight of your luggage.

Nestled within the picturesque county of Lincolnshire, Grantham Train Station is a vital hub on the East Coast Main Line, connecting travelers to a multitude of destinations across the UK. Whether you're a local resident, a commuter, or a visitor exploring the beautiful landscapes and historic sites, Grantham offers a seamless journey with a wealth of facilities to cater to your every need.
Grantham Station is dedicated to ensuring you have everything you need for a convenient journey. The ticket office operates with ample access across all seven days of the week, complemented by ticket machines for easy ticket collection. Accessibility is a key priority, with step-free access throughout the station, accessible ticket machines, and ramps available for smooth train access. The station lounges and heated waiting rooms offer a comfortable space to relax, complete with accessible seating options.
Traveling with luggage or have specific needs? Although there are no luggage storage facilities, the station staff is on hand to assist where possible, and feedback is welcomed to improve services. Secure station accreditation, customer information screens, and on-site CCTV ensure safety and security. Plus, you can always refresh at the coffee shops or access cash from the available ATM machines for your journey.
Once you've arrived at Grantham, onward travel is a breeze. Taxis are readily available, and Grantham Taxis can be pre-booked to ensure your ride. Buses are conveniently accessible, with detailed information about local services available for planning more extensive travels. Rail replacement services also depart directly from the station's front, ensuring minimal disruption to your travel plans. Situated in the picturesque village of North Queensferry, Scotland, this charming train station offers locals and travelers a gateway to explore both local and far-flung destinations with ease. Whether you're enjoying a scenic journey across the iconic Forth Bridge or planning a jaunt to Edinburgh, North Queensferry train station serves as an ideal starting point.
North Queensferry train station is equipped to make your journey as seamless as possible. Although there isn't a ticket office, you can collect your pre-purchased tickets or buy them directly using the available ticket machines, which are accessible to everyone. For passengers requiring assistance with hearing, an induction loop system is in place for a better travel experience. CCTV cameras provide an added layer of security, guaranteeing peace of mind during your time at the station.
While waiting for your train, you can relax in the seating area. However, it's worth noting there are no accessible toilets or baby changing facilities, so planning ahead is advised. Car parking is available 24/7 with 13 free spaces, including one designated for Blue Badge holders.
North Queensferry station scores reasonably well on accessibility, featuring a Category B classification, which indicates partial step-free access. Ramps provide access to platforms, but a connecting footbridge with stairs is present for crossing between platforms. If you require additional assistance, bookings for help can be organized through the easy-to-navigate Passenger Assist service.
Connecting with other modes of transportation from North Queensferry is straightforward. Taxis can be booked through resources like TrainTaxi. However, if your journey demands a bus service, further details about bus routes and schedules can be found at Traveline Scotland or by contacting them directly at 0871 200 22 33.
For those travelling when rail services are replaced, convenient rail replacement buses pick up and drop off from the car park at Platform 1, ensuring no destination is out of reach.
